The court of William and Mary in Tudor England appreciated fine furniture and the artistry of cabinetmakers, and was quite pleased to see a new design featuring cross-cut veneers of the yew tree, laid upon the doors of a handsome cabinet. Below the cabinet stood walnut turned legs and a shaped stretcher. A few of these exist today in museums, and our aged reproduction would stand beside them very ably.
